Subject: Handover — Willowgate reminder job

Hi,

Welcome aboard. The appointment reminder job for Willowgate Clinics runs nightly at 02:15 and pulls tomorrow's bookings, then queues SMS and email notices. It's a plain cron task on the scheduler box; logs rotate weekly. If it fails, it's almost always a timeout on the bookings database — just rerun it manually once. The job authenticates to the bookings database with the connection string below.

Thanks,
Marisol

warehouse DSN: mssql://rusdor_svc:0FSWCn9@db-951a.paliqforge.local:5432/ulawyn

14:22 — Tansy pointed out the user module split at Quillbarn went sideways because the shim still wrote sessions to the monolith's table. We rolled the extraction service back, re-ran the dual-write check, and it passed clean on the second attempt. For the sync notes, the clean run's identifier is attached below.

session token of tajef-bageg = htk21_5d90d574934f3ccae6437

ALERT: Meridock calendar sync conflict. Fires when the Ostrella connector detects the same event modified on both sides within the merge window. Current behavior: last-writer-wins with a conflict record logged. Do not silence without checking conflict volume first. Resolution procedure and conflict record format are documented on the internal page below.

wiki page, tahaf-tajog: https://jira.ordindyn.corp/pipeline

- [ ] Step 7: Archive cold storage buckets (Glacierline tier). Confirm both ceremony witnesses are present, verify bucket manifests match the Oxbow ledger, then seal the archive key shares. Plugin authors may observe but not handle shares. Once sealed, the archive index itself is encrypted and can only be reopened with the passphrase below.

vault phrase of badup-hahig = tamael-aldael-kelmir-istael-fenok-istwyn-tamius-jorath-oliion